Make each bullet one line Include SAT score (if >2000) Make it all past tense (i.e. not "oversee," "oversaw Get rid of any Microsoft Office items under technical skills Get rid of "technology" under interests, or make it something more specific - this goes with "cars" as well Make "Computer Technician and Salesman" just "Computer Technician," the former seems a bit too wordy/vague for a position. You can explain your sales skills during an interview, in any case.
